#9c9e09 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c9e09 is composed of 61.2% red, 62%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.3%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 60.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 32.7%. #9c9e09 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ff12 with #393d00.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#9c9e09

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a01 is the darkest color, while #fefef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c9e09

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575750 is the less saturated color, while #a2a403 is the most saturated one.
